For example, if we flip a coin in the air and get the outcome as Head, then again if we flip the coin but this time we get the … WebbIn statistics, Basu's theorem states that any boundedly complete minimal sufficient statistic is independent of any ancillary statistic.This is a 1955 result of Debabrata Basu.. It is often used in statistics as a tool to prove independence of two statistics, by first demonstrating one is complete sufficient and the other is ancillary, then appealing to the …

WebbHow can we check whether two events are independent using probabilities? There are three simple ways to check for independence: Is P (A) × P (B) = P (A and B)? Is P (B A) = P (B)? Is P (A B) = P (A)?
